Phase 3 — A real SaaS. Build on Open SaaS, a free $300-value SaaS template the Wasp team maintains. Auth, payments, an admin dashboard, file uploads, AI integrations, deploy, and more. - Source: dev.to / 4 months ago
This was about the same time we launched Open SaaS, our free, open-source SaaS starter. Using the same logic, you'd have expected that AI would have killed boilerplate starters by now. But we noticed the opposite trend. - Source: dev.to / 5 months ago
